Lab Notebook
From July 1st to August 16, our main goal was to clone the blue light-controlled circuit. We transformed various chromoproteins such as amilCP, tsPurple, and amilGP into a pSB1C3 and mRFP into pSB1K3, pSB1C3, and pSB1A3. After the successful transformations and minipreps, we tried cloning the circuit ourselves, but after several failures, we outsourced work to BIOFAB, a plasmid cloning service, to clone our circuits for us.
